A delightful blend of cherries and apples topped with a crunchy coconut crumble, then baked to golden perfection. A family favourite, irresistible comfort dessert. This delightful recipe is courtesy of Chef Jeff Simonetta.

Fruit Filling
  • 3 cups cherries, pitted
  • 3 cups apples, peeled and diced
  • 1/2 cup granulated sugar
  • 2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1/2 teaspoon ground cinnamon
Coconut Crumble Topping
  • 1 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1/2 cup desiccated coconut
  • 1/2 cup brown sugar, packed
  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ter, chilled and diced
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  1. Preheat the oven to 190°C (375°F). Grease 6 ramekins, and place on a baking tray.
  2. In a large saucepan, combine cherries, apples, sugar, flour, vanilla extract, and ground cinnamon.
  3. Place over a medium heat and stir until the fruits are evenly coated and start to soften.
  4. Transfer the mixture evenly to the prepared ramekins.
  5. In another bowl, mix flour, desiccated coconut, brown sugar, and salt.
  6. Add chilled diced butter and use your fingers to combine until crumbly.
  7. Sprinkle the coconut crumble mixture evenly over the fruit filling.
  8. Bake in the preheated oven for 15-20 minutes or until the top is golden brown, and the filling is bubbly.
  9. Allow the crumble to cool slightly before serving. Enjoy warm, optionally with a scoop of vanilla ice cream.
